This study was conducted to find out the effect of using story activities program on improving kindergarten language skills in Amman. A total of 45 children participated in the study. The sample was chosen randomly from the private kindergartens in Amman, divided into two groups: 25 children in the experimental group and 20 in the control group. The study utilized a list of language skills, behavioral measures, and an achievement test. The findings showed that there is a statistically significant difference α≤0.05 in kindergarten children’s language skills due to teaching method, in favor of the story activities program. It also showed no statistically significant difference α≤0.05 due to gender and the interaction between gender and method. The study recommends utilizing the story activities to improve language skills. (Published abstract)
